How Much Does a Bachelor’s in Parks & Rec from Nichols Cost?

$36,540 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Nichols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

In 2019-2020, the average part-time undergraduate tuition at Nichols was $753 per credit hour for both in-state and out-of-state students. The average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ates are shown in the table below.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$35,290$35,290
Fees$1,250$1,250
Books and Supplies$1,400$1,400
On Campus Room and Board$13,950$13,950
On Campus Other Expenses$2,200$2,200

Nichols Bachelor’s Student Diversity for Parks & Rec

48 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
14.6% Women
14.6%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
During the 2019-2020 academic year, there were 48 bachelor’s degrees in parks and rec handed out to qualified students. The charts and tables below give more information about these students.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Women made up around 14.6% of the parks and rec students who took home a bachelor’s degree in 2019-2020. This is less than the nationwide number of 49.2%.

undefined

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Racial-ethnic minority graduates* made up 14.6% of the parks and rec bachelor’s degrees at Nichols in 2019-2020. This is lower than the nationwide number of 37%.
